Upper Intake Manifold: Installation

- Clean and inspect all of the sealing surfaces of the upper intake manifold.NOTE: If the engine is repaired or replaced because of upper engine failure, typically including valve or piston damage, check the intake manifold for metal debris. If metal debris is found, install a new intake manifold. Failure to follow these instructions can result in engine damage.
- Position the upper intake manifold and install the 7 bolts.
- Tighten the bolts in 2 stages in the sequence shown below.
- Stage 1: Tighten to 10 Nm (89 lb-in).
- Stage 2: Tighten an additional 45 degrees.
NOTE: Install new upper intake manifold gaskets. - Tighten the bolts in 2 stages in the sequence shown below.
- Install the 2 upper intake manifold support bracket bolts.
- Tighten to 10 Nm (89 lb-in).
- Connect the MAP sensor electrical connector and attach the wiring retainer.
- Connect the PCV tube to the upper intake manifold.
- Attach the engine control wiring harness retainer to the upper intake manifold.
- Connect the EVAP
tube-to- EVAP
canister purge valve quick connect coupling and the brake booster vacuum tube to the upper intake manifold.
- Attach the fuel tube and EVAP tube-to- EVAP canister purge valve tube retainer to the upper intake manifold.
- Connect the EGR valve electrical connector and attach the wiring retainer.
- Connect the EVAP canister purge valve electrical connector.
- Connect the electronic throttle control electrical connector.
- Install the EGR tube fitting to the EGR valve.
- Tighten to 40 Nm (30 lb-ft).
- Install the battery. For additional information, refer to REMOVAL AND INSTALLATION .
- Install the ACL outlet pipe. For additional information, refer to REMOVAL AND INSTALLATION .

When to See a Mechanic
Stop DIY work and contact a certified mechanic immediately if any of the following apply:
- • You smell fuel, burning insulation, or see smoke.
- • Brakes feel soft, pull hard to one side, or make grinding noises.
- • The engine overheats, stalls repeatedly, or misfires under load.
- • You are missing required tools, torque specs, or safe lifting equipment.
- • You are not confident in the next step or safety outcome.
